How many interview rounds does bebo Technologies have for a QA Engineer, and what are the stages?
At bebo Technologies, the QA Engineer process typically moves from an Initial Screening to Technical Assessments, then a Final Conversation with management or director-level personnel. The Technical Assessments include multiple assessments designed to evaluate technical capabilities and knowledge. Expect the loop to focus on both depth and fit across these stages.
How difficult are interviews for bebo Technologies QA Engineer roles, and what is the offer rate?
Candidates reported the QA Engineer interviews as “average” difficulty. The reported offer rate is 56% across 16 interviews. Use that as a signal that you should prepare thoroughly, but the bar is not described as extreme.
What topics does bebo Technologies test for QA Engineer interviews, especially around Selenium and automation?
Selenium is a top tested topic, including Selenium Grid. The role also heavily covers software testing fundamentals, test case design, and test automation, plus general testing frameworks. On the technical side, Java (core) and OOP concepts show up, so be ready to connect Java knowledge to automation and test design.
What automation and testing skills should I prioritize for bebo Technologies QA Engineer interviews?
Focus on automation framework design, not just individual scripts, since that is described as a cornerstone of the technical evaluation. You should be able to explain how your framework is structured, how exceptions are handled, and how testing results are reported or logged. Be prepared to discuss how you use Selenium Grid alongside CI/CD tooling, since Selenium Grid is explicitly listed.
What coding topics can come up for a bebo Technologies QA Engineer interview?
The interview guide includes programming and logic patterns such as writing a program to check a string palindrome and to reverse a string. Java-specific items include explaining core OOPS concepts, how to use the static keyword, and differences between access specifiers. You may also see a pattern-based coding problem using arrays.
